Hjem programvare Hva er sammensatte applikasjoner? - definisjon fra techopedia

Hva er sammensatte applikasjoner? - definisjon fra techopedia

Innholdsfortegnelse:

Anonim

Definisjon - Hva betyr sammensatte applikasjoner?

Sammensatte applikasjoner er applikasjoner som er bygd fra en kombinasjon av flere eksisterende funksjoner ved bruk av forretningskilder. Sammensatte applikasjoner er programvareledelsamlinger samlet for å gi forretningsevne. Disse eiendelene er vanligvis gjenstander som brukes uavhengig, noe som muliggjør sammensetning og utnyttelse av spesifikke plattformfunksjoner.


Å bruke en sammensatt applikasjon kan avlaste en bruker fra å bytte mellom applikasjoner. Det gir klar tilgang til flere applikasjoner på samme sted, med den ekstra fordelen ved å legge til og fjerne funksjoner manuelt. Sammensatte applikasjoner kan sammenlignes med mashups. Imidlertid bruker sammensatte applikasjoner forretningskilder, mens mashups bruker nettbaserte, for det meste gratis ressurser.

Techopedia forklarer sammensatte applikasjoner

De fire lagene med sammensatte applikasjoner er data, applikasjon, produktivitet og presentasjon. En løsningsarkitekt må forholde seg til komponenter, en komposisjonsstabel og sammensatte applikasjonsspesifikasjoner. For å velge en komposisjonsstabel, må en eller flere containere velges fra hvert lag. Et sett av komponenttyper må kunne distribueres i containerne. Komponenter velges ved å definere et depot av eiendeler, som skal trekkes fra komponenttyper basert på forretningsbehov. Metoder for å koble eiendelene må også defineres for å gi en tverrfunksjonell prosess. Disse tilkoblingene er løst koblet.

En applikasjon anses som en godt tilpasset sammensatt applikasjon hvis den samsvarer med en standard arkitektonisk utforming og inneholder følgende funksjoner:

  • En rik brukeropplevelse for å samle mange applikasjonstyper i en enkelt klientvisning
  • Konsistent og enhetlig GUI
  • Fullstendig godkjenning og konfidensiell informasjon
  • Fleksibilitet til å bruke serviceorienterte arkitekturfunksjoner som gjenbrukbarhet og løs kobling
  • Oppfør deg som unik applikasjon for heterogene applikasjoner
  • Komponent interkommunikasjon
  • Gjenbruk av databehandlingsmidler
  • Sammensetning av deler
  • Samle flere applikasjoner i en enkelt klientvisning
  • Gi tilgang når som helst og hvor som helst i et tilkoblet miljø

Klientens sammensatte applikasjonsinfrastruktur er et sammensatt applikasjonsløpsmiljø som er nødvendig for å installere og utføre applikasjoner som er spesielt sammensatt i et Websphere portal-servermiljø. Sammensatte applikasjoner har også en spesifisert struktur. Informasjonsarbeidere utgjør det høyeste nivået i strukturen. De får tilgang til dokumenter og forretningsinformasjon gjennom portaler. De lager også dokumenter under forretningsaktiviteter, som er en del av større forretningsprosesser som koordinerer aktivitetene til systemer og mennesker. Aktivitetene styres gjennom prosessspesifikke forretningsregler som påkaller ressurser i et tjenestegrensesnitt. Forretningsregler blir endelig brukt på innholdet i disse dokumentene for å trekke ut, transformere og overføre informasjon til neste trinn i prosessen.


Bruksområder for sammensetning inkluderer arbeidsflyter, dokumenter, forretningsaktiviteter og regler, ordninger, skjermbilder for brukergrensesnitt, rapporter, beregninger, etc.

Hva er sammensatte applikasjoner? - definisjon fra techopedia